Define Species And Genus . A genus is a group of species that are closely related through common decent. Genus refers to a broader category that groups together closely related species. Genus, biological classification ranking between family and species, consisting of structurally or phylogenetically related species or a single. Species is one of the most specific classification that scientists use to describe animals. Species, a level of biological classification comprising related organisms that share common characteristics and are capable of interbreeding.
